Kang Joo-hyun is a political science professor at Sookmyung Women’s University in South Korea, known for his expertise in political dynamics and governance. He has commented on recent political upheavals in the country, particularly regarding the implications of the presidential election that follows the impeachment of former President Yoon Suk Yeol.
